    Abstract
    During the industrial revolution 4.0, the creative industry sector was one of the most important fields. Creative industry-based economic development produces added value based on knowledge, ideas and creativity, which is manifested into a work or creative product, to be marketed later. Medan City as a metropolitan city has enormous prospects in terms of the development of creative industries, therefore a forum is needed for discussion and cooperation for creative industry players that can be used as a support for skills and knowledge, so as to produce superior quality products and be able to compete in national and foreign markets. The design of the creative hub aims to create a creative economic ecosystem in Medan City by providing educational, research and collaboration facilities for creative actors and commercial, exhibition and recreational facilities for use by the general public. The application of contemporary architectural style to the creative hub building is shown in the attractive shape of the building with a dominant curved shape, glass facades to incorporate natural light, materials with neutral colors such as white, gray and brown wood, color play and murals on the facade to depict creativity, creation of spatial experiences with play of scale at the entrance and atrium, educational and commercial facilities and public spaces in the plaza and innercourt.
